The Neighborhood:
Downtown Calgary is a vibrant hub in Alberta, Canada, characterized by a mix of modern skyscrapers and historic buildings set against the stunning backdrop of the Rocky Mountains. The cityscape is dominated by tall towers of glass and steel, housing corporate headquarters, financial institutions, and businesses.
The Calgary Tower stands as an iconic landmark, offering panoramic views of the city and surrounding landscapes. The area is also home to cultural institutions like the Glenbow Museum and Arts Commons, hosting various performances and exhibitions throughout the year.
Stephen Avenue Walk, a pedestrian street, is lined with shops, restaurants, and cafes, making it a bustling area for both locals and tourists. During the warmer months, Prince's Island Park becomes a focal point with its green spaces, walking trails, and hosting events like the Calgary Folk Music Festival.
Calgary's downtown is well-connected through its extensive network of walkways known as the "+15 system," elevated indoor pedestrian bridges that link buildings, providing shelter during harsh winter months.
The city's energy industry has historically been a significant part of its economy, reflected in the corporate presence downtown, but Calgary is also evolving into a more diverse and dynamic metropolitan area with a growing arts scene and a range of cultural activities.
Getting Around:
Navigating downtown Calgary is relatively straightforward and offers various transportation options for locals and visitors alike.
Walking: The downtown core is pedestrian-friendly, especially along Stephen Avenue Walk and the riverfront. It's a great way to explore the shops, restaurants, and parks in the area. The +15 system, a network of indoor pedestrian bridges, also allows for convenient travel between buildings, particularly during winter when temperatures drop.
Public Transit: Calgary Transit operates an efficient network of buses and the CTrain (light rail transit) that serves downtown. The CTrain has multiple stations within the downtown area, making it convenient for getting around. The fare system allows for easy transfers between buses and trains if needed.
Biking: Calgary has dedicated bike lanes and pathways, making cycling a viable option for navigating the downtown core. Bike-sharing programs like Lime or other rental services are available for short-term use.
Driving: While driving is an option, traffic congestion during peak hours can be a concern. There are parking lots and street parking available, but it might be more convenient to use public transit or alternative means of transportation due to potential traffic and parking challenges.
Ride-Sharing and Taxis: 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ft operate in Calgary, providing additional flexibility for getting around downtown. Taxis are also readily available for shorter trips or convenience.
Overall, the city's layout and transportation options make it relatively easy to move around downtown Calgary, offering various choices based on individual preferences and needs.
